Tuna Cakes

Crispy Tuna Cakes with Zesty Sriracha Aioli Delight

Delightful Tuna Cakes, quick to prepare and gluten-free, topped with zesty Sriracha Aioli.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Chilling Time 20 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Servings: 4 cakes
Course: Appetizers
Cuisine: Asian
Calories: 220

Ingredients
  

For the Patties
  • 10 oz high-quality canned tuna drained well
  • 1 large egg lightly beaten
  • ½ cup panko breadcrumbs use gluten-free for a gluten-free option
  • 3 green onions thinly sliced
  • 2 cloves garlic minced
  • 1 tbsp fresh ginger grated
  • 1 tbsp soy sauce or tamari if gluten-free
  • 1 tsp sesame oil optional
  • ½ tsp black pepper to taste
  • 2 tbsp vegetable or canola oil for frying
For the Sriracha Aioli
  • ½ cup mayonnaise or Greek yogurt for a lighter option
  • 1-2 tbsp sriracha to taste
  • 1 tbsp lime juice fresh-squeezed is best
  • 1 clove optional garlic minced

Equipment

  • Mixing Bowl
  • non-stick skillet
  • Spatula

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. Whisk together mayonnaise, sriracha, lime juice, and optional garlic in a small mixing bowl. Refrigerate.
  2. Flake the drained tuna in a large bowl, then add beaten egg, panko, green onions, minced garlic, ginger, soy sauce, sesame oil, and pepper. Mix gently.
  3. Divide tuna mixture into 8 equal portions and shape into 1-inch thick patties. Refrigerate for 15-20 minutes.
  4. Heat oil in a skillet. Fry patties until golden on each side, about 3-4 minutes.
  5. Transfer to a paper towel-lined plate to absorb excess oil. Serve warm with aioli.

Notes

Ensure that the tuna is well-drained to avoid soggy cakes. Customize with vegetables if desired.
